Talk me out of a 25’ Pilot by SelectOil4818 in Sienna

[–]nolanblack 2 points3 points  (0 children)

My wife has a 2024 Sienna and her sister has a 2025 Pilot. Both took delivery in late September 2024. Everyone loves the Sienna and nobody likes the pilot. None of the kids are comfortable in the Pilot 3rd row, it’s difficult to get in and out of, and fuel mileage is brutal. Wife’s sister is getting 300 km per tank fuel in the pilot, and my wife is getting 800-900 km on tank in the Sienna. The Pilot has the bigger fuel tank of the two, but far less range.

2015 to 2016-19 upgrade by [deleted] in ToyotaTacoma

[–]nolanblack 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I traded a 15’ DCSB manual TRD Sport for a 17’ DCLB auto TRD Sport. I have many regrets. The reason I traded was to get the longer bed. But I don’t like the way the center console opens, I don’t like the new location of grab handles, don’t like the new style of emergency brake handle, don’t like the cup holder arrangement, don’t like the auto transmission, don’t like the gutless 3.5l V6, don’t like the storage behind the rear seats, don’t like the reduction in bed storage compartments, don’t like the 4wd selector knob, don’t like the oil filter style or location, I don’t like the taillights, and I don’t like the cheap feeling of the interior plastic and seat fabrics. I should mention that I do like the slow lowering solid feeling tailgate, the fuel economy readout, the outside temperature indicator, and the power sliding rear window.
